Peter Chawaga is a senior editor with Bitcoin Magazine and has been covering Bitcoin's technology and culture since 2017. He has profiled prominent Bitcoiners, covered global adoption trends and was the first to report that El Salvador would make bitcoin a legal tender currency. He has more than 10 years of professional experience in writing, editing and publishing to the web. He holds a degree in English and journalism from Wake Forest University. When Chawaga isn't reading or writing, he's watching baseball with his daughters. He HODLs bitcoin.
